程序便捷使得我们更好的理解控制因此使用高速计数器的第一步,就是利用向导生成高速计数器的初始化程序和中断程序,普通的计数太慢了满足不了对高频率信号的采集了,所以诞生了PLC高速计数器的应用,对于高速计数器也就是设置--设置--设置--设置--罢了(高速计数器可做输出,输入捕获(下面叫时钟,单个时钟),正交解码(编码器两路信号输入,根据两路信号可以判断正反转/正反转之和差/好多东东)),中断(高速计数器触发中断要比一般的中断迅速),说白了就是受到扫描周期的影响..*有代表性的例子,,PLC采集编码器的数据//输出脉冲控制电机转速。泾阳plc
921高速计数器的简介
对超出CPU普通计数器能力的脉冲信号进行测量。
S7200 SMART CPU提供了多个高速计数器(HSC0-HSC3)以响应快速脉冲输入信号。高速计数器的计数速度比
PLC的扫描速度要快得多,因此高速计数器可独立于用户程序工作,不受扫描时间的限制,用户通过相关指令,设置相应的特殊存储器控制计数器的工作。高速计数器的一个典型的应用是利用光电编码器测量转速和位移高速计数器的工作模式和输入。
凤县plc高速计数器有8种工作模式,每个计数器都有时钟、方向控制、复位启动等特定输入,对于双向计数器,两个时钟都可以运行在*高频率上,高速计数器的*高计数频率取决于CPU的类型,在正交模式下,可选择1×(1倍速)或者4×(4倍速)输入脉冲频率的内部计数频率。高速计数器有8种4类工作模式(1)无外部方向输入信号的单减计数器(模式0和模式1)
用高数计数器的控制字的第3位控制加减计数,该位为1时为加计数,为0时为减计数
(2)有外部方向输入信号的单碱计数器(模式3和模式4)方向信号为1时,为加计数,方向信号为0时,为减计数
(3)有加计数时钟脉冲和减计数时钟脉冲输入的双相计数器(模式6和模式7)若加计数脉冲和减计数脉冲的上升沿出现的时间同隔短,高速计数器认为这两个事件同时发生,当前值不变,也不会有计数方向的变化的指示。否则高速计数器能捕捉到每个独立的信号。
兴平plc(4)AB相正交计数器(模式9和模式10)
它的两路计数脉冲的相位相差90°,正转时A相时钟脉冲比B相时钟脉冲超前90
反转时,A相时钟脉冲比B相时钟脉冲滞后90°·利用这特点,正转时加计数,反转时减计数。
太白plc高速计数器的输入分配和功能见表94表94高速计数器的输入分配和功能